Viết chương trình tính tổng a) S=1*2+2*3+3*4+-N*(N+1) b) S=2+4+6+…+2*N c) S=1+3+5+…+(2*N+1) Với N nhập từ bàn phím 1. Sử dụng For… Do 2. Sử

Viết chương trình tính tổng
a) S=1*2+2*3+3*4+….N*(N+1)
b) S=2+4+6+…+2*N
c) S=1+3+5+…+(2*N+1)
Với N nhập từ bàn phím
1. Sử dụng For… Do
2. Sử dụng While…Do

0 bình luận về “Viết chương trình tính tổng a) S=1*2+2*3+3*4+-N*(N+1) b) S=2+4+6+…+2*N c) S=1+3+5+…+(2*N+1) Với N nhập từ bàn phím 1. Sử dụng For… Do 2. Sử”

  1. a)

    *for…do

    uses crt;

    var n,i:integer;

          S:longint;

    begin

            clrscr;

            write(‘Nhap n: ‘); readln(n);

            S:=0;

            for i:=1 to n do

                    S:=S+(i*(i+1));

            write(‘S= ‘,s);

            readln;

    end.

    *while…do

    uses crt;

    var n,i:integer;

          S:longint;

    begin

            clrscr;

            write(‘Nhap n: ‘); readln(n);

            S:=0;   i:=1;

           while i<=n do

                   begin

                          S:=S+(i*(i+1));

                          i:=i+1;

                   end;

            write(‘S= ‘,s);

            readln;

    end.

    b)

    *for…do

    uses crt;

    var n,i:integer;

           S:longint;

    begin

           clrscr;

           write(‘Nhap n: ‘);  readln(n);

           S:=0;

           for i:=1 to n do

                   S:=S+2*i;

           write(‘S= ‘,s);

           readln;

    end.

    *while…do

    uses crt;

    var n,i:integer;

           S:longint;

    begin

           clrscr;

           write(‘Nhap n: ‘);  readln(n);

           S:=0;   i:=1;

           while i<=n do

                  begin

                         S:=S+2*i;

                         i:=i+1;

                  end;

           write(‘S= ‘,s);

           readln;

    end.

    c)

    *for…do

    uses crt;

    var n,i:integer;

           S:longint;

    begin

           clrscr;

           write(‘Nhap n: ‘);  readln(n);

           S:=0;

           for i:=0 to n do

                  S:=S+((2*i)+1);

           write(‘S= ‘,s);

           readln;

    end.

    *while…do

    uses crt;

    var n,i:integer;

           S:longint;

    begin

           clrscr;

           write(‘Nhap n: ‘);  readln(n);

           S:=0;  i:=0;

           while i<=n do

                  begin

                         S:=S+((2*i)+1);

                         i:=i+1;

                  end;

           write(‘S= ‘,s);

           readln;

    end.

    Bình luận
  2. a,

    For…do:

    var n,i: integer; S: real;

    begin

     read(n);

     For i:=1 to n do 

      S=S+i*(i+1)

     write(S);

    end.

    While…do:

    var n, i: integer; S: real;

    begin

     read(n);

     while i <= n do

      begin 

       S:=S+i*(i+1);

       i:=i+1;

      end;

     write(S);

    end.

    b, 

    For…do:

    var n,i: integer; S: real;

    begin

     read(n);

     For i:=1 to n do 

     S:=S+2*i;

     write(S);

    end.

    While…do:

    var n,i: integer; S: real;

    begin 

     read(n);

     while i <= n do

      begin

        S:=S+2*i;

        i:=i+1;

      end;

     write(S);

    end.

    c,

    For…do:

    var n,i: integer; S: real;

    begin

     read(n);

     For i:=1 to n do

     S:=S+(2*i+1);

     write(S);

    end.

    While…do:

    var n,i: integer; S: real;

    begin

     read(n);

     while i <=n do

      begin

        S:=S+(2*i+1);

        i:=i+1;

      end;

     write(S);

    end.

    Bình luận

Viết một bình luận

Viết chương trình tính tổng a) S=1*2+2*3+3*4+-N*(N+1) b) S=2+4+6+…+2*N c) S=1+3+5+…+(2*N+1) Với N nhập từ bàn phím Sử dụng While…Do

Viết chương trình tính tổng
a) S=1*2+2*3+3*4+….N*(N+1)
b) S=2+4+6+…+2*N
c) S=1+3+5+…+(2*N+1)
Với N nhập từ bàn phím
Sử dụng While…Do

0 bình luận về “Viết chương trình tính tổng a) S=1*2+2*3+3*4+-N*(N+1) b) S=2+4+6+…+2*N c) S=1+3+5+…+(2*N+1) Với N nhập từ bàn phím Sử dụng While…Do”

  1. a)

    program tinh_S;

    uses crt;

    var n,i:integer;

          s:longint;

    begin

            clrscr;

            write(‘Nhap n: ‘);  readln(n);

            s:=0;

            for i:=1 to n do

                    s:=s+(n*(n+1));

            write(‘S= ‘,s);

            readln;

    end.

    b)

    program tinh_S;

    uses crt;

    var n,i:integer;

          s:longint;

    begin

            clrscr;

            write(‘Nhap n: ‘);  readln(n);

            s:=0;

            for i:=1 to n do

                    s:=s+2*n;

            write(‘S= ‘,s);

            readln;

    end.

    c)

    program tinh_S;

    uses crt;

    var n,i:integer;

          s:longint;

    begin

            clrscr;

            write(‘Nhap n: ‘);  readln(n);

            s:=0;

            for i:=0 to n do

                    s:=s+2*n+1;

            write(‘S= ‘,s);

            readln;

    end.

    Bình luận
  2. a, 

    var n, i: integer; S: real;

    begin

     read(n);

     while i <= n do

      begin 

       S:=S+i*(i+1);

       i:=i+1;

      end;

     write(S);

    end.

    b, 

    var n,i: integer; S: real;

    begin 

     read(n);

     while i <= n do

      begin

        S:=S+2*i;

        i:=i+1;

      end;

     write(S);

    end.

    c, 

    var n,i: integer; S: real;

    begin

     read(n);

     while i <=n do

      begin

        S:=S+(2*i+1);

        i:=i+1;

      end;

     write(S);

    end.

    Bình luận

Viết một bình luận